Family & Households in Major Urban

How families and households are made up across the area.

Couples with children make up 60% of families in Major Urban, making them the most common home type. This is a diverse area where the typical home holds 2.6 people, a figure that has remained steady since 2011.

Households

Average household size.

Homes here are larger than in most similar areas, though they are about the same as the national figure of 2.5 people. Around 25.2% of people live alone, a figure that has risen slightly since 2011.

Families

Family types and one-parent families.

One-parent families make up 13.4% of the total, which is about the same as the national figure of 14.1%. This proportion has barely changed over the last ten years.
